This has been my favorite Mexican place in Anderson since I moved here in 2020. I still love their food and salsa, but now their prices have gone up so much on everything, they have priced me away from their place. Prices have gone up every where as we know, but some restaurants haven't gone up at all, like El Arriero in Anderson. They have had the same menu since 2020. They still do $1.99 margaritas on Mondays. My bill is less than half of Puerto Nuevo. My advice, be realistic, cut your prices way back down, or go out of business!!! $36 per lb for crab legs? Give me a break!!! I've seen them at Kroger recently for $5.99 per lb. Complete ripoff!!!
